Round 8: Silverstone British GP Meeting: 16 July 1983
Not sure of the full entry for the GP support. I've included everyone listed in the partial result I have, plus all of the cars mentioned or pictured in Performance Car's report, which covered both the GP support and the previous Donington round, so is a bit sketchy on both. Dave Brodie might have been a DNF- the PC report incldes a pic of the Starion going off into the catchfencing, but doesn't say if this was in practice or the race, or whether it was a race-ending incident Geoff Kimber-Smith is also pictured in the article- I'm guessing he was a DNS, as the pic shows the Nashua-sponsored Corolla with heavy damage on the right front corner after hitting the wall. A few points from the report: Allam was troubled by a down-on-power engine 'I was having to hold 3rd where I'd normally use 4th, even though the car was handling beautifully' Patrick Watts now had a Metro Turbo- both Metros were suffering from misfires on a hot day. Alan Minshaw just failed in a last lap bid to take the class lead from Richard Longman The BS Automotive/Cheylesmore 635 for Stuck was described as a one-off' due to backing from Diners Club .The Cheylesmore outfit hoped to field the car again, but admitted it was unlikely. A deal must have been put together though, as it actually did the rest of the season.... A tyre war was building up in the 1600 class, with several leading competitors switching from Dunlop to Avon since early season. Conversely, Chris Hodgetts had changed from Avons to Dunlops, and Alan Minshaw having previously switched to Avons, reverted to Dunlop for the GP support. John Morris appeared to be hedging his bets- the Donington class win having been achieved with Avons on the front of the Scirocco and Dunlops on the rear.... This being the BTCC, trouble was naturally brewing- Frank Sytner had protested the TWR Rovers at Donington over the rear inner wheelarches... Last edited by KA; 22 May 2010 at 16:52. |

Round 9: Donington. 8 August 1983
Again, I've got a partial result, plus I've listed every car mentioned or pictured in the Performance Car mag report. This was an eventful one- Stuck was back in the BS/Cheylesmore 635 (though no Diners Club sponsorship here) and would become the first driver to lead a 1983 BTCC round in anything other than a Rover... Lovett led from the start, until brake problems combined with increasing pressure from Soper and Stuck caused him to go off- the Rover got stuck fast and wouldn't re-start, handing the lead to the BMW driver. Soper however took the lead a lap later. Stuck then came under pressure from Sytner before they clashed on lap 12 at Redgate, Frank ending up out of the race with broken suspension and rear bodywork damage...Stuck briefly grabbed the lead back from Soper on lap 29, but Soper retook it before the end of the lap, maintaining his advantage to the flag Win Percy had been in touch with the leaders throughout and finished 3rd Jeff Allam retired fairly early in the race after a clash with Sytner broke the Rover's front suspension- he'd been struggling with oversteer and a weak engine anyway. Gordon Spice was pleased with a 4th place- his first finish in the Rover, and Mike Newman brought his Capri home in an impressive 5th Andy Rouse dominated Class B, helped by a bad first lap for Pond and visits to the pits for both Dooley and Watts, Andy building a huge lead over Hamish Irvine's RX7. Hamish retired on lap 24, but the Rouse Alfa began to suffer from fuel starvation, and was forced to slow down. Meanwhile, Pond was recovering from his poor start... Rouse moved over to let the leaders lap the Alfa on the last lap, not realising Pond's Metro was tucked in behind them, enabling Pond to snatch an unexpected class win Alan Minshaw won Class C after a close battle with Chris Hodgetts, the two taking turns to lead the class. Behind them, Richard Longman had a long scrap with the Morris Scirocco, until the VW dropped out with a sick engine The Datapost team had a fairly fraught weekend- Longman and Curnow having 3 engine failures in testing and practice, plus a shunt on Saturday morning for Longman, and another damaged engine. They had to cobble together two serviceable engines from the broken ones Oh, and the protest saga continued- Sytner protesting the Rovers over their valve gear, and TWR protesting the Sytner and Cheylesmore 635s in respect of bodywork and spoilers. TWR had also issued a writ against the RAC earlier in the week for mishandling the earlier protest. The paddock rumour on Sunday was that Tom had been seeking an injunction to prevent the race going ahead..... Last edited by KA; 22 May 2010 at 17:40. |

Found another old copy of Performance Car in the loft, so can fill in some background on this one
Round 10: Brands Hatch. 29 August 1983
Pole for Soper, with Stuck qualifying the Cheylesmore 635 second in typically spectacular style...Lovett was 3rd and Allam 4th. Brodie had the Starion going well, only doing two laps in the first session, but they were good enough for 3rd fastest. Stuck and Allam improved in the second session, but the Starion would still start from the second row in 5th. Win Percy was a little off the pace, waiting for a new engine spec from Arden Pond was fastest in Class B, and Rob Hall's Escort fastest in C At the start Soper led from Lovett, and Brodie. Stuck having a poor start, only getting away 5th, and becoming part of what PC describe as an 'almighty squabble' for third between Brodie Allam, Percy, and Gordon Spice's Rover. This resolved itself when Brodie's tyres started to go off, and 'he lost it at the head of the train, taking Percy with him. Contact was inevitible, but the result was bizarre- despite minimal panel damage to either car (Brodie was able to continue), the Toyota suffered the indignity of having the near-side whieel and suspension torn clean away, apparently the result of the steering being on full lock (Percy trying to avoid the collision) when contact was made, catching the revolving tyre' The Supra was out, and Stuck's 635 left in a secure third, with Allam and Spice fighting over 4th. Brodie continued, but his nearside front tyre 'cried enough' after 19 laps. At the front Soper began to struggle with oversteer (Rover were having tyre problems at Brands- apparently a shortage resulted in them running tyres normally used on the rear of the Rover on the front as well), and was caught and passed by Lovett on lap 9. Steve then fell back into the clutches of Stuck, the yellow Rover and the 635 starting the last lap virtually nose to tail- Soper just hanging on, as Stuck was alongside him at the flag- the two being credited with identical race times. In Class B, the Metros led from the start, until contact with another car sidelined Pond with a broken oil cooler- Tony leaving Brands by helicopter, heading for Heathrow and a flight to South Africa for a rally commitment. Little more than a lap later, Watts too was out- a head gasket failure on the Metro handing a virtually unchallenged win to Rouse. Hamish Irvine took 2nd after a great dice with Jon Dooleys Napolina Alfa, until Jon had to pit to fix a loose plug lead Class C was a battle between Chris Hodgetts and Rob Hall- Many of the other Class C contenders, particularly Minshaw, being in subdued form and fighting various problems. Hall began to catch Hodgetts late in the race, as Chris had to ease off with a deflating left front tyre- the two Escorts crossing the line together (and both credited with the same time) only yards ahead of the Soper/Stuck dead-heat- 'the four cars crossed the line in one mad scramble'! Behind them, Curnow took 3rd and class fastest lap from an unhappy Minshaw, who claimed the pressure of leading the class in the championship might have been getting to him... Greenhalgh's yellow Golf was fifth from Longman who also had to pit to re-attach a plug lead. The Brands result gave Rouse the Class B championship win, while the overall title and Class A would go down to the wire at the last round. Curnow only had a 'mathematical' chance of toppling Minshaw from the Class C title lead. Of course, it would all work out very differently, with Rouse eventually being crowned 1983 champion about a year later.... Points after 10 rounds: 1- Soper (Rover- A) 62 2- Lovett (Rover- A) 59 3- Rouse (Alfa GTV6- B) 52 4- Minshaw (VW Golf- C) 47 |

As far as Win and the Celica Supra goes - the car wasn't homologated until 1 Aug 1983 so I have always wondered why it was allowed to compete before that time - perhaps there was some rule over there about being able to compete provisionally once the paperwork had been submitted?
I think the race at the Silverstone GP in July was its first, not surprised it was listed as a DNS prior to that time. There also seems to have been some 'homologation creep' in other areas; car 2 comes out at some stage in 1984 with flares when they aren't homologated until 1 Aug 1985. As far as I know Arden Conversions did do all the mechanical work on the cars: they certainly built the engines, the cam profiles were theirs and so was the injection/induction work on the cars. I don't know the workshare split between HOB and AC. John HOB Celica Supra Group A #1. |

The Shawcross tribunal seemed to have a specific remit re: the '83 results. When they announced their decision at the end of July '84, they made 2 decisions, over-riding previous findings of scrutineers at and after races:
1. Remove a Ted Grace BMW from the results of a Silverstone meeting, due to an illegal steering mechanism. (Could this be the loss of 4 points, 21 vs 25, round 6?) 2. Remove the TWR Rovers from the results due to illegal panels and modified rockers. (The statement printed in Autosport doesn't name any drivers, just the teams. Is it possible that TWR had only nominated Soper and Lovett, or that only Soper and Lovett were protested, so Allam was outside the remit of the tribunal?) |

Not sure about Point 1, though TWR certainly protested both the Ted Grace/Frank Sytner and Cheylesmore 635s at least once during the season- Just had a look at the result as listed by Frank de Jong, and it seems to be the GP meeting where Sytner had issues with the scrutineers- the first four finishers (the 3 TWR Rovers and Sytner's 635) are all listed as DQ'd for technical infringements. http://homepage.mac.com/frank_de_jon...tone%20GP.html Point two sounds like the outcome of the protests Sytner instigated against TWR at the two Donington rounds, in June... (rear inner wheelarches- is this the infamous 'African-market-spec' modification that led to the team being dubbed 'Third World Racing' by some wit at the time?) ...and again in August (valve gear- IIRC this was the modified rockers issue). TWR counter-protested both 635s on this occasion over alleged bodywork irregularities. Before the second Donington meeting Walkinshaw had taken out a writ against the MSA alleging mishandling of the previous protest- according to PC magazine, the rumour in the paddock at Donington was that he'd tried to get an injunction to prevent the race happening at all! I'm guessing that the Donington affair may have been the beginning of the process that led to Shawcross? I don't remember whether it was 1983 or 84 (I think the latter) but as I recall there's a lovely quote in one of the Performance Car articles from IIRC, Jon Dooley who apparently said something like 'Their legal budget is bigger than our racing budget for the whole season'. I wondered very briefly if the removal from the championship table of Soper and Lovett had been based on solely on the evidence gathered after Sytner's protests at the two Donington rounds- Jeff Allam's car was a DNF at both of these, so somehow was never actually inspected by the scrutineers over the protested issues at these two meetings? That doesn't stack up though, as Soper and Lovett scored one retirement each from these two rounds as well, only one TWR car seeing the chequered flag at both Donington races. The Rovers were also apparently protested at the Silverstone GP meeting (between the two Donington races), where all three finished- though I'm not sure on what grounds. Still, there's enough there to shoot my 'Allam's car somehow never being inspected over the protests' theory down pretty comprehensively! |
